What Is Eviction Law?

A landlord cannot evict you for any reason. A mixture of federal, state, and local laws regulates evictions and when they can happen. In most cases, a landlord will need to prove that you violated the terms of your lease or that you received proper notice that you could not renew your lease.

What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Landlord Tenant Lawyer To Help With an Eviction?

You can fight an eviction. You should talk to a landlord-tenant lawyer about your case if you receive an eviction notice for alleged violations such as:

  • Failure to pay rent
  • Noise violations
  • Safety and maintenance violations
  • Illegally subletting

Sometimes landlords try to evict tenants in retaliation for reporting unaddressed safety and maintenance issues or for discriminatory reasons like a tenant’s race or gender.

How Can a Landlord-Tenant Lawyer Help Me With an Eviction?

Your landlord must follow the eviction process and timeline detailed in state and local laws. A lawyer can determine if your landlord violated any of your rights in evicting you, such as discrimination or failing to give you proper notice. A lawyer can gather the right evidence to make a strong case in court on your behalf.

What Questions Should I Ask When Trying To Find a Landlord-Tenant Lawyer in Marlborough?

These questions can help you decide if you feel comfortable and confident that a lawyer has the qualifications, experience, and ability to manage your case well. Many lawyers offer free consultations that allow you to understand your options and get specific legal advice before hiring them. The top questions to ask include:

  • How have you handled cases like mine?
  • What are the potential outcomes of my case?
  • What is the timeline for my case?
  • Are there alternative dispute resolutions available, like mediation?
  • What is your billing and fee structure? What if I can’t afford to pay?
  • How long have you been practicing in Massachusetts?
  • Do you have access to experts who can support my case?
  • How do you approach evidence collection?
  • What is your approach to negotiations and settlements?
  • What will my involvement be during the process?
